Current functional MRI and PET brain scans show that many complex and complicated actions are performed by the body before the ‘thinking’ parts of the brain come on line. Current hypotheses point towards the ‘thinking’ brain parts are busy thinking of a reason for why we just did what we did.

Human behavior is amazingly complex and poorly understood.

Andrew Torba is the founder of Gab, described by Wikipedia as “a haven for neo-Nazis, racists, white supremacists, white nationalists, antisemites, the alt-right, supporters of Donald Trump, conservatives, right-libertarians, and believers in conspiracy theories such as QAnon”.
